Handover for eng sync — Kestrelkit SDK parity

Quick one: the Swift and Kotlin SDKs for Kestrelkit are nearly at parity; only batch uploads and offline retries lag on Kotlin. Tarene has the parity matrix on the Owlmere wiki. To unlock the shared test-fixture bundle, use the recovery passphrase that follows below.

unlock words, hahip-baduf: holwyn-istath-julvan

Subject: Password reset cut-over summary for Wednesday sync

Team,

The new reset flow on Keystrand went live Tuesday at 02:00. Token issuance moved from the legacy mailer queue to the new dispatch service, and one-time links now expire after 20 minutes instead of 24 hours. Error rates held under 0.2% through the window; the single spike traced to a stale cache node, since drained. Legacy endpoints return 410 as of this morning. The flow now runs with the following configuration.

service settings:
PRAIX_LOG_LEVEL=error
PRAIX_METRICS_HOST=metrics.praix.qorvelcorp.corp
PRAIX_POOL_SIZE=16

HANDOVER NOTE — from Director Sova to Director Brandt

Hi team — passing the baton on the inventory write-down. Short version: the Meridale warehouse count confirmed roughly 4,200 units of the old Pinewright line are unsellable at list, so finance is booking the write-down this quarter. Brandt will own the clearance plan; sales leads, expect revised discount authority by Friday. Don't promise customers anything on the discontinued SKUs until that lands. One more thing — the sensitive part is right below.

management briefing: Casvanek Logistics plans to lower the Druox list price by 49.1 percent in April. The board signed off on a budget of $16.5 million for Project Rusath. The renewal with Kasvanix Partners closes at $67.9 million a year, 33.9 percent above the last contract. Project Casath slips by one quarter because of the staffing delay.